Scope Definition is a crucial stage in project management that involves identifying, documenting, and agreeing upon the project's scope, including its deliverables, features, functions, and boundaries. It's the foundation upon which the rest of the project is built, ensuring that all stakeholders are on the same page and working towards a common understanding of the project's objectives and outcomes.
